Introduction to Blowout Preventers
Blowout preventers (BOPs) are crucial safety devices in the oil and gas industry, designed to prevent uncontrolled releases of crude oil or natural gas from a well. Understanding Three Ram Blowout Preventers
Three ram blowout preventers are engineered to provide superior sealing capabilities compared to traditional systems. Their design includes three distinct rams: a pipe ram, a shear ram, and a blind ram. Each of these rams serves a specific function:
1. **Pipe Ram**: This ram effectively seals around drill pipes, preventing fluid escape and ensuring well control during drilling operations.
2. **Shear Ram**: Designed to cut through drill pipes and seal the well in case of an emergency, the shear ram is vital for protecting against blowouts.
3. **Blind Ram**: This ram provides a complete seal on the wellbore, essential for operations where no pipe is present.
